Reading a novel in separate volumes refers to dividing the novel into different parts to achieve a better understanding and mastery of the novel's content. Normally, a novel would be divided into several chapters. Each chapter contained an independent storyline and character image. The reader could better understand the theme and plot of the novel by reading each chapter. The advantage of reading in separate volumes was that it could help readers better grasp the pace and rhythm of the novel, and it could also prevent readers from getting tired from reading for too long. In addition, reading in separate volumes can also help readers better understand the metaphor and symbolism in the novel and better understand the meaning of the novel. In novel reading, reading by volume is a common method to help readers better understand the content of the novel and improve reading efficiency and experience.

The dividing of a novel into volumes usually referred to the splitting of a novel into multiple chapters or volumes in order to present the story more clearly. These chapters or volumes could be created independently or they could be connected to form a complete story system. The purpose of dividing the novel into volumes was to better show the story and make the story more coherent. At the same time, it could also help the readers better adapt to the reading rhythm. When writing a novel, dividing the novel into volumes could also better manage the content of the novel and facilitate the release and update of subsequent chapters. Dividing a novel into volumes would allow readers to enjoy the reading experience better and allow the author to better manage the content of the novel.
